Sedgwick delivers tech-enabled risk, benefits, and integrated business solutions, functioning as a third-party administrator (TPA) for claims management and loss adjusting. The firm provides comprehensive services across diverse industries, utilizing advanced technology and analytics to streamline operations. Core capabilities include expert claims handling, accurate loss assessment, and administrative support, mitigating client risks, ensuring business continuity.
The company was founded in 1969 by Robert "Bob" Young, who recognized a significant market opportunity serving self-insured employers. Young established Sedgwick Claims Management Services, Inc. to offer specialized third-party administration for workers’ compensation and disability programs. This insight addressed the growing need for independent, expert claims handling for companies managing their own risk.
Sedgwick serves a broad spectrum of clients, from large corporations to public entities, seeking optimized claims and risk management. Its vision is to be a global partner in caring for people and reducing loss impact. It aims to restore health and productivity for individuals and efficiently manage assets for businesses, fostering resilience.
